> > Running YDL 2.2 in KDE on an iMac Rev. B/160MB
> RAM.
> 
> > I am configuring in the Linux Kernel Configurator,
> > putting the .config file in /usr/src/Linux and run
> > make dep, make clean and then make bzImage.
> 
> "make bzImage" does not work in ppc. use "make
> vmlinux"
> (or just "make").
